Transaction 17ad571dee1341ef734fc2c442bef500ffab5053c4ba7bb2bb99dd2bb4a31f62

1 Input
2 Outputs
  • 17ad571dee1341ef734fc2c442bef500ffab5053c4ba7bb2bb99dd2bb4a31f62:0
  • value  610000
    address  3Ptv3wvMHGAF8QEeX4kmZrSMSAHHWtopWF
  • 17ad571dee1341ef734fc2c442bef500ffab5053c4ba7bb2bb99dd2bb4a31f62:1
  • value  389859594
    address  3D7R7QvY52mhzWEVYStKadViLQznSYFj7C